Default Unit cap

What's the maximum of units allowed/moddable in the game?
I think its 5000 per player, right?
The question is, is that the maximum of units deployed in space or the maximum that you can have in storage in your planets and ships?

Default Re: Unit cap

The max units is a setting at the begining of the game, but that refers to units in space. The units you can have in cargo is only limited by cargo capacity.

Default Re: Unit cap

The limit for units in space is settable at game setup. Default is 2000 if I recall correctly, but can be set as high as 20,000 and I think as low as 100. The default itself can even be changed in settings.txt.

You do get a message. It says something about not being able to launch because the maximum limit has been reached. I haven't hit it in while, but used to all the time with pre-gold SE4 before they fixed the bug where you couldn't self-destruct mines.

As the others pointed out there is no limit on number of units in storage other then the total amount all you planets, ships and bases can carry.
